Los Angeles General+ USC Medical Center

Action at LAG-USC on the hospital steps

By standing together as a union, Los Angeles General + USC housestaff have won:

higher wages

improved benefits

better working conditions


Benefits

Your negotiated benefits include: legal services, vision, supplemental benefits, Employee Assistance Program, disability, education, COBRA, and LA gap insurance.

Wages

$10,000 annual housing allowance

3 meals a day at home institution

$27/day for meals on rotation

Education & Funding

$1,400 annual education stipend

$300,000 QI Research Fund

$125,000 Diversity, Equity, and Inclusion fund

Patient Care Trust Fund

Looking to Improve Patient Care? LAC+USC and Harbor-UCLA has one of the oldest and largest Patient Care Funds, with LA County contributing $1,210,000 and $980,000 respectively. Click here to apply or for more information.

Welcome Bonus

$500 PGY 1 “welcome bonus” ($1,900 for annual education stipend in first year)

$3,900 annual Chief Stipend

Legal Services

CIR Legal Services (CIRLS) offers legal assistance with immigration, landlord/tenant matters, family matters, consumer issues, wills, medical licensure, post-residency contract review, and more.

Student Loan Consultation

Southern California residents are eligible to receive an educational loan consultation benefit at a deeply discounted price of $179.

Due Process

If you find yourself in a disciplinary process or facing a contract violation, you have the right to union representation.
